So, we head into this ‘abundant’ pasta joint, with limited expectations (the only way to fly).

The waitress comes over. She’s from NY, (she announces) and there are things on this menu you can really, really enjoy. ‘HA’! (I’m thinking). I say: “I don’t suppose you have gluten free pasta, do you”? THIS WOMAN whips out an Allergen information brochure the size of New England which tells me what is: Gluten Free, Peanut free, Tree Nut free, Egg free, Dairy free, Fish free, ShellFish free, and Soy free.

Am I in love? Or what? Are you kidding me? A restaurant that beats to the drum of what we want today?

So… sooooo cool. I must say: I am impressed.
